    Yesterday I watched a biography about Oscar de la Hoya on tv. It focused on his early days.

    When his mother was dying, he made a promise to her: that he would win the Gold medal in the Olympic games. Two years later, he won the final in Barcelona. Oscar explained his return to the US, then how he visited the cemetery. It was very touching.

    You can't hate a guy like Oscar. He's a role model, a life of success.
